Payment services all over the world are integrating QR codes into their systems. More than just a storage of data, QR code technology now forms a key component of many financial apps, allowing users to make transactions by simply scanning.

In this post, we look into the factors that have brought QR codes to the core of fintech and the different technologies that redefine finance in 2026.

QR code payment market growth and the factors behind it

According to a recent QR code statistics report, the global market value for QR code payments is expected to reach $38.2 billion by 2030, or more than $20 billion in 2026.

This growth is influenced by the following factors:

  • increasing smartphone penetration
  • rising digital banking adoption
  • growing preference for contactless transactions

Smartphone penetration

Data from Statista shows that the smartphone mobile network subscriptions worldwide reached almost 7.3 billion in 2025. With the world population at 8.3 billion, according to Worldometer, that means almost 88% of the world has smartphones.

What’s more, the same data indicates that this number is expected to grow beyond 7.9 billion in only 3 years, likely increasing the use of QR codes in finance. 

Preference for contactless transactions

The increasing adoption of mobile payment systems, particularly QR-based systems, is also contributing to the growth of the QR code payment market. 

Several countries, especially those in the Asia-Pacific region, have been working on incorporating QR code payments into the average consumer experience. 

A recent example is Pakistan’s latest initiative requiring QR code payment options in every retail store. This new mandate is part of the government’s program to reduce reliance on cash payments and normalize a convenient and secure method of financial transactions.

Several other industries, such as hospitality and transportation, are also increasing adoption as they benefit from the technology’s ease of use, a consumer base with smartphones, and minimal hardware investment. 

Digital banking adoption

Aside from the preference for contactless payments, the adoption of QR codes in finance by digital banks also contribute to the market’s growing value. 

One way how it is shaping the market is by answering the increasing demand for cross-border QR code payments. This leads various financial institutions to establish connections with foreign banks to develop a platform for their combined user base. 

Digital wallets are also using QR codes as a means of transferring money between accounts. QR codes can be created on QR Tiger’s static QR code generator in-app to facilitate transactions at any time, or they can be made to request a specific amount of money upon demand.

Emerging technology in QR financial tech

QR codes aren’t the only solutions reshaping finance in 2026. In fact, it’s being supported by several other systems.

1. Dynamic QR code in finance

One of the many technologies that is shaping finance is dynamic QR code generation. This type of QR code enables systems to generate unique, secure codes that facilitate financial transactions.

The difference between a static QR code vs dynamic one is how they embed the content. Static QR codes permanently store the exact data entered into the software, while dynamic generation involves creating a short URL, which leads to the exact content.

This allows dynamic QR codes to include features that secure cashless payments. For example, they can be set to expire after a specified period. 

When used by financial apps, this requires both parties to make the transaction upon request, ensuring the QR code isn’t abused afterward. 

2. Cross-border interoperability

Many digital wallets and banks now use QR codes to move money. Additionally, transferring between them is possible because they are often a part of the same financial network. However, support for other currencies outside the country isn’t guaranteed.

In the past few years, systems that allow users from different countries to make payments to each other have been sought after. For example, the Association of Southeast Asian Nations (ASEAN) announced in 2023 an initiative to implement a universal QR code that supports local currencies. 

Another QR code payment system with cross-border support is Wero, a 2024 project that connects various payment systems across Europe. Most banks in Germany, France, and Belgium are already integrated with Wero, with more expected to join over the coming years.

3. Biometrics

To further secure QR codes in finance, many systems require scans to be performed with specific apps. This is especially prevalent in banking apps that include QR code scanning. 

Apps like these are typically secured with PINs and two-factor authentication, but another popular method for further securing financial transactions is biometrics. 

Biological data, such as fingerprints and facial scans, is so unique that it prevents malicious actors from misusing a user’s finances. 

4. Blockchain-enabled QR codes

The blockchain is famous for securing and maintaining a decentralized database. It is for this reason that cryptocurrency relies primarily on this technology, and why it is expected to be incorporated into various digital payment systems. 

Among these systems, QR code payment technology might also be a potential beneficiary of blockchain security.

While challenges remain, especially in integrating the two technologies, blockchain-enabled QR codes enable secure transactions with decentralized verification, further protecting money transfers even when the app is used to create a static QR code payment. 

5. AI-powered fraud detection

Researchers are also investigating methods to detect QR code tampering and fraud using various machine learning techniques.

To detect tampering, neural networks can be used to verify the integrity of scanned QR codes. When combined with a new generation system that embeds tamper-resistant data within codes, unauthorized modification becomes more difficult for bad actors.

Another research avenue is the use of AI to identify fraudulent QR code transactions. In response to the difficulty of detecting fraud in an ever-increasing number of UPI transactions, researchers in India have developed a machine learning model to differentiate authentic transactions with a QR code scanner from questionable ones.
